Under what environmental conditions can the laser cutting machine be used to better play its performance

When using laser cutting machine to cut workpieces, we often ignore the influence of environmental factors on the performance of laser cutting machine. Suitable environment will improve the working efficiency and processing accuracy of laser cutting machine, while unsuitable environment will reduce these processing advantages. It will even reduce the service life of the laser cutting machine. Let’s talk about the environmental conditions under which the laser cutting machine can be used to give better play to its performance:

Environmental condition I: ensure that the laser cutting machine can cut in a dry environment
Since the machine itself and each important component of the laser cutting machine are made of metal materials, and the laser cutting machine is often used to cut metal materials, it must be ensured that the laser cutting machine can cut in a clean and dry environment. If the environment is wet, the machine will rust. This will affect the accuracy of processing and cause the laser cutting machine to malfunction or damage.
Environmental condition 2: ensure the input power of the laser cutting machine is stable and efficient
Since the laser cutting machine uses laser to cut the workpiece, and the power required by the laser is relatively high, the power input must be stable and efficient when the laser cutting machine is working, and the voltage and current input of the laser cutting machine must be stable. Try to make the laser cutting machine in a separate workshop to process the workpiece, so as to avoid the diversion of power from other machines, which will affect the normal work of the laser cutting machine.
Environmental condition 3: ensure that there is no static electricity in the working environment of the laser cutting machine, and avoid the impact of static electricity on the laser cutting machine
When the laser cutting machine is working, pay attention to whether there is static electricity. If there is static electricity in the working environment, it will cause the circuit board of the laser cutting machine to be affected by static electricity, resulting in short circuit or failure.
